Add 32/28 and 63/14
1st number: 1 4/28, 2nd number: 4 7/14
32/28 + 63/14 is 79/14.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 28 and 14 is 28
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 28 - For the 1st fraction, since 28 × 1 = 28,
32/28 = 32 × 1/28 × 1 = 32/28 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 14 × 2 = 28,
63/14 = 63 × 2/14 × 2 = 126/28 - Add the two like fractions:
32/28 + 126/28 = 32 + 126/28 = 158/28 - 158/28 simplified gives 79/14
- So, 32/28 + 63/14 = 79/14
